Detailed Interface stats API takes sw_if_index 60/11260/2
authorNeale Ranns <nranns@cisco.com>
Wed, 21 Mar 2018 13:44:01 +0000 (09:44 -0400)
committerChris Luke <chris_luke@comcast.com>
Wed, 21 Mar 2018 20:22:27 +0000 (20:22 +0000)
Change-Id: Id09d777c1706c1d613b14b719bcac596194465cd
Signed-off-by: Neale Ranns <nranns@cisco.com>
src/vnet/interface.api

index 4d1b5ac..25ba703 100644 (file)
@@ -544,13 +544,16 @@ autoreply define delete_loopback
 /** \brief Enable or disable detailed interface stats
     @param client_index - opaque cookie to identify the sender
     @param context - sender context, to match reply w/ request
+    @param sw_if_index - The interface to collect detail stats on. ~0 implies
+                         all interfaces.
     @param enable_disable - set to 1 to enable, 0 to disable detailed stats
 */
 autoreply define collect_detailed_interface_stats
 {
   u32 client_index;
   u32 context;
-  u8 enable_disable;
+  u32 sw_if_index;
+  u8  enable_disable;
 };
 
 /*